I found a couple of free moments between setup and our start time so I wandered out into the large gathering area outside of the ballroom and shot off a few out the windows. This one is looking down the street at City Hall in Springfield, MA.

It is a composite of two shots that I auto-aligned and masked in Photoshop to remove a few cars driving down the street and use the yellow light instead of the green. Then I spot-healed a few reflections on the window and brought into Lightroom 2 Beta to process it as a B&W. One of the features I like in LR2 is the Post-Crop Vignette. That’s one of the things that has always frustrated me in LR1 and I’m glad the team worked it out for this version.
